About Alberto Gulminetti

 
 
  • Biography
    I’m Alberto, I’m a painter and a videomaker living in Rome.

    After attending Arts High School in Turin, I pursued my passions up to Rome, where I settled and still live, to study at a Cinema Academy, and later at the Academy of Fine Arts where, in 2017, I graduated with honors.
    In the two-year period 2018/19 I attended at painter Mario Salvo’s studio, taking painting lessons with the palette knife technique, also known as Stratigraphic Palette Knife.

    I have been exclusively working with video and digital art for several years but, recently, I felt the need to get back to painting.

    My work has been influenced by the abstract artworks of Nicolas De Stael, Jean-Paul Riopelle, Olivier Debré, Sergio Scatizzi, Sean Scully among other artists. The art of the second post-war period influences more my production.

    The word that best translates my search is: Image.
    The deep and ancestral meaning of the Image is the basis of my work.
    I am a visual person - I like to work/create at 360º with painting, video and digital art.
    I believe that we cannot arrive at an absolute truth about the meaning of images - of all images, and therefore of the ultimate Image: the concept of Representation.

    But.

    But with the gesture and the color that I put on the canvas I circumvent the truth and compose doubts, because this is the only thing that I have: the Doubt.
    The Abstract is a form of language before language, it brings us into a state of pre-knowledge, the state in which babies are found.

    I love abstraction because it allows me to reach the bottom of knowledge without saying a word.
